Bonair Winery
Bonair Winery Review
After years of amateur wine-making in California, the Puryear family began commercial wine production in their native Yakima Valley in 1985 under the Bonair Winery name. One of the older Yakima Valley wineries, Bonair offers a large tasting room reminiscent of a european chalet that sits among the vineyards, and a duck pond, which was voted one of Washington's best places for a kiss. Visit the tasting room and you will likely meet the winemaker, Gail Puryear or his wife, the "wine goddess" Shirley. Bonair makes cabernets, cabernet francs, chardonnays, gewürztraminer port, merlots, Rieslings, and more. Visitors are welcome to picnic here, and vinyard/production tours are available by appointment.
